Genetic changes in the lifetime of individual trees

CBC’s Quirks and Quarks featured a UBC student’s search for genetic mutations in old-growth giant Sitka spruce in the Carmanah Walbran Provincial Park on Vancouver Island. Vincent Hanlon, a forestry master’s student, took samples by climbing to the very top of the trees, some of which were as much as 84 metres tall. He hopes to discover genetic differences between needles taken from the top and bark samples taken from the bottom.
